Why acne scars tend to persist in your 30s

Your skin’s turnover slows down with age, and lifestyle habits like stress, lack of sleep, smoking/drinking, and shaving irritation can make redness or uneven texture harder to clear.

Dermapen 4: how it works

Dermapen 4 uses very fine needles to create micro-channels and trigger natural regeneration. As collagen increases, texture can become smoother and pores less noticeable.

Sessions, downtime, and pain

  • Frequency: about once every 4 weeks
  • Common course: 3–5 sessions or more, depending on depth and severity
  • Pain: often minimized with topical anesthetic; some tingling is common on the nose and jawline
  • Downtime: usually short; expect temporary redness

Combining Dermapen 4 with serums (vitamin C, growth factors, etc.) may further enhance results.
